Loving the NXT and having a great time getting adjusted to it. I've run into a couple of issues, though, and could use some help figuring out what's going on.
First, I would like to configure the 'Tempo B' option on the mini-stick to allow me to use it as a button, hold to shift modes. I've seen many explanations for how to do this in the VKBDevC program. Select the button in the physical mapping, change the DDL entry to 'Tempo B' and set the button to associate it with. The problem is, when I select 'Tempo B' I get no option to assign a button. Like so:
I have no idea what to do from here. The option should appear but it simply doesn't. I've tried flashing the firmware again, setting the stick to defaults, etc. Nothing seems to provide that option. Please assist!
Second, the red LED which normally lights up indicating that the mode on the hat has switched only works when the stick has been reverted to defaults. As soon as I do anything to the stick the LED ceases to function. Note that this *includes* simply setting the default configuration on the stick immediately after setting it to default and calibrating it. I did see the post indicating that you can manually configure the LED by going to the 'Global' tab and selecting the 'LEDs' vertical tab. Here I can find the entry for LED 11 with the correct color, but the DDL allowing me to select the state is disabled. That's the case for *all* of the states of the LED. Nothing seems to provide that option here, either. Help!
